Qualifications
Pharm. D degree, required.
2) Valid California Pharmacist license, required.
3) Specialty pharmacy experience, highly desired.
4) Meds to beds experience, highly desired.
5) Ability to establish and maintain cooperative working relationships with coworkers and professional staff.
6) Ability to set priorities which accurately reflect the relative importance of job responsibilities.
7) Ability to work independently and follow-through on assignments with minimal supervision.
8) Ability to effectively communicate orally on a one-to-one basis using appropriate vocabulary and grammar to obtain information, explain policies and procedures, and to persuade others to adopt a specific opinion or action.
9) Knowledge of and ability to perform age specific and disease specific pharmacokinetic calculations.
10) Knowledge of Specialty drugs and disease states.
11) Ability to evaluate and resolve staffing needs.
12) Knowledge of state and federal regulations relating to the practice of pharmacy.
13) Ability to review and assess the appropriateness of prescriptions with respect to age specific, disease state specific considerations.
14) Ability to lead the team and manage the workload efficiently.
15) Current experience in an outpatient pharmacy setting, required.
16) Ability to perform all tasks in an outpatient and specialty pharmacy setting.
17) Ability to help the Pharmacy Supervisor lead the team, set expectations.
18) Ability to engage with the patients, promote adherence and treat them with empathy and compassion.
